When I lived in Seattle I used old carpet for paths in the garden I had
there. I dug up lawn to make the beds and put down the carpet so I would
not have to mow between the beds. Eventually the grass came thru the carpet
but there were no weeds in it. Just nice lush grass. Some people use
boards, some bricks. I don't know which side of the Cascades you are so I
don't know if you are on the wet side or the dry side.
